Indemnification Contract
"I need an Indemnification Contract for my software development company to protect against intellectual property claims when providing services to a major financial institution, with specific provisions for data breach incidents and third-party code usage."
1. Parties: Identifies and defines the indemnifier and indemnitee with their full legal names and details
2. Background: Sets out the context and purpose of the indemnification agreement
3. Definitions: Defines key terms used throughout the agreement, including 'Loss', 'Claim', 'Indemnified Event', etc.
4. Scope of Indemnification: Clearly defines what losses, damages, or claims are covered by the indemnity
5. Indemnification Obligations: Details the specific obligations of the indemnifier, including payment terms and timing
6. Exclusions: Specifies what events, losses, or circumstances are explicitly excluded from the indemnity
7. Claims Procedure: Sets out the process for making and handling indemnification claims
8. Notice Requirements: Specifies how and when notices of claims must be given
9. Defense of Claims: Outlines procedures for defending against third-party claims and allocation of control
10. Duration: Specifies how long the indemnification obligations remain in effect
11. General Provisions: Standard contract clauses including governing law, jurisdiction, and entire agreement
1. Insurance Requirements: Required when the indemnifier must maintain specific insurance coverage
2. Security: Used when additional security (such as bank guarantees) is required to support the indemnity
3. Subrogation Rights: Include when dealing with insurance-related aspects or recovery rights
4. Third Party Rights: Needed when third parties may have rights under the indemnity
5. Limitations of Liability: Include when there are caps or limitations on the indemnification amount
6. Dispute Resolution: Required when specific dispute resolution procedures are needed beyond court jurisdiction
7. Confidentiality: Include when the indemnification relates to confidential information or requires confidential treatment
1. Schedule of Specific Indemnified Events: Detailed list of specific events or circumstances covered by the indemnity
2. Schedule of Insurance Requirements: Detailed specifications of required insurance coverage, limits, and terms
3. Schedule of Claim Procedures: Detailed procedures and forms for making and processing claims
4. Schedule of Pre-Existing Claims: List of any known claims or circumstances that exist at the time of agreement
5. Schedule of Excluded Events: Detailed list of specific exclusions from the indemnity coverage
